Canals in England administered by British Transport Commission; pre-war situation; wages; war time research; consideration of utilization of routes which might be adopted, i.e., Trent and Mersey narrow canal, Severn Estuary, Mersey Canal, and Thames; communicating routes; Birmingham area; some other canals; abandonments; finance; economic surveys; coordination of planning; operating efficiency.
